General procedure for the catalytic hydrogenation of methyl benzoate as substrate: Under argon, a Keim autoclave was charged with [Ru Cl2(R-BINAP)(dm02] (0.01 mmol, 0.05 mol %) and S,S-DPEN (0.01 mmol, 0.05 mol %) followed by THF (2 ml) and the solution stirred for 5 minutes. Then a solution of the desired ester (20 mmol) in THF (2 ml), followed by more THF (2×1 ml), and a solution of tridecane (1 mmol) in THF (2 ml), as internal standard, followed by more THF (2×1 ml), were successively added to the autoclave. Finally, solid NaOMe (1 mmol, 5 mol %) was added and the autoclave was pressurised with hydrogen gas at 50 bars and placed in a thermostatted oil bath set at 60 C. After the mentioned time, the autoclave was removed from the oil bath, and cooled in a cold-water bath. Then, an aliquot (0.4 ml) was taken, diluted with MTBE (5 ml), washed with aq. sat. NH4Cl (5 ml), and filtered over a plug of celite and analyzed by GC.
